  "description": "The POP to TOP converts the points of a POP to the pixels of a TOP.  By default it treats the POP points as one unstructured list of points and chooses a square TOP resolution that fits all the points into the image.  It by default converts the P position attribute to pixels in 32-bit float image channels.  The alpha of the image is set to a value of 1, except for the pixels that do not represent any point, where the pixels are set to 0 (the \"active\" channel).",
